Understanding Pinterest SEO: The Basics

Although countless users perceive Pinterest largely as a visual discovery platform, mastering Pinterest SEO is critical for maximizing visibility and engagement. Pinterest operates similarly to a search engine, where optimized content can greatly increase a user's reach. The platform utilizes algorithms that focus on relevant and high-quality pins, making it vital for creators to implement effective SEO practices.

Key elements of Pinterest SEO include optimizing pin descriptions, implementing alt text, and picking the right image formats. Compelling titles and brief, informative descriptions assist users quickly recognize the content's value. In addition, creating visually appealing pins designed for Pinterest's vertical format can attract user attention.

Leveraging boards effectively, organizing content into relevant subjects, and maintaining a consistent posting schedule also help with improved SEO performance. By embracing these foundational aspects of Pinterest SEO, users can create a more impactful presence and increase their chances of attracting a larger audience.

Finding Keywords: Discovering the Right Phrases

Effective keyword research is essential for improving Pinterest visibility and engagement. This process involves identifying the exact terms and phrases that potential users are searching for on the platform. By using tools such as Pinterest's search bar, users can discover trending keywords and related searches, which provide data into audience interests.

Evaluating rival profiles and successful pins also yields valuable data, uncovering which keywords drive traffic. It is critical to concentrate on long-tail keywords, as these typically have decreased competition and address niche markets, improving the chance of engagement.

Additionally, incorporating trending and seasonal keywords can further enhance visibility, matching content with ongoing interests. By emphasizing relevant keywords and integrating them organically into pin descriptions, titles, and boards, users can considerably improve their likelihood of reaching a broader audience. In summary, strategic keyword research creates the basis for a effective Pinterest strategy.

Approaches to Keyword Optimization

An optimized pin description can significantly improve visibility on Pinterest, bringing in more users and boosting engagement. Successful keyword optimization entails identifying pertinent terms that resonate with the target audience. Leveraging tools like Pinterest Trends and Google Keyword Planner can assist in discovering high-performing keywords connected to specific niches. It is important to integrate these keywords naturally within the pin description, guaranteeing they fit seamlessly into the content. Additionally, using long-tail keywords can help target more specific searches, increasing the likelihood of reaching interested users. By strategically placing keywords in the first few lines of the description, creators can maximize their chances of appearing in search results, ultimately driving higher traffic and fostering greater interaction with their pins.

The Critical Role of Visuals and Image Optimization

Visuals play an essential role in grabbing attention and driving engagement on platforms like Pinterest, where users are drawn to compelling images. To maximize the effectiveness of visuals, image optimization becomes vital. This entails using high-quality images that match the interests of the target audience, as well as incorporating relevant keywords in file names and alt text. In addition, optimizing image dimensions guarantees that visuals display correctly across various devices, elevating user experience.

Strategically utilizing colors, fonts, and branding elements within images can also foster brand recognition and attract users. The use of vertical images is highly effective on Pinterest, as they consume more visual space and tend to stand out in feeds. Ultimately, a well-optimized image not only grabs attention but also encourages users to engage, share, and save content, driving increased traffic and visibility for businesses on the platform.

Utilizing Rich Pins for Improved Engagement

Integrating Rich Pins into a Pinterest strategy can greatly enhance user engagement and interaction. Rich Pins deliver additional information directly on the pin itself, elevating the user experience and encouraging more clicks. There are three types of Rich Pins: Product, Article, and Recipe, each tailored to deliver relevant data. For instance, Product Pins display real-time pricing and availability, making them particularly useful for e-commerce brands. Article Pins enable detailed descriptions and authorship, helping to increase traffic to blog posts. Recipe Pins provide cooking times, ingredients, and serving sizes, appealing to food enthusiasts. By using these features, businesses can create a more interactive and informative experience, resulting in higher engagement rates. Rich Pins not only make content more discoverable but also establish credibility and trustworthiness. Overall, leveraging Rich Pins can significantly strengthen a brand's presence on Pinterest, driving more traffic and fostering a loyal audience.

Evaluating Your Performance: Refining Your Strategy

A comprehensive analysis of performance metrics is crucial for improving a Pinterest strategy. By evaluating key indicators such as impressions, saves, and click-through rates, marketers can discover which types of content resonate most with their audience. Regularly reviewing these metrics allows for the identification of trends and patterns, enabling informed adjustments to content strategies and timing.

Integrating analytics tools can streamline this process, offering more comprehensive insights into audience demographics and engagement levels. If particular pins consistently exceed others, it may signal a need to check now create related content or optimize underperforming pins. Moreover, adjusting keywords and descriptions based on search trends can further enhance visibility.

Ultimately, this repetitive process of performance analysis fosters a responsive strategy that evolves with audience preferences, ultimately driving increased traffic and engagement on Pinterest. The ability to adjust based on data secures a competitive edge in the constantly evolving landscape of social media marketing.

Are There Any Tools Available for Scheduling Pinterest Posts?

Yes, several tools exist for scheduling Pinterest posts, including tools such as Tailwind, Buffer, and Hootsuite. These tools enable users to automate pinning, improve posting schedules, and track performance metrics, improving overall Pinterest strategy and effectiveness.
